Continuum

Rating:★★★★★
Category:Music
Genre: Alternative Rock
Artist:John Mayer
Coming out with his first single off the 3rd album, the song Waiting on the World to Change, John starts us off with a slightly irreverent and rebellious take on the status quo. Thats about as rock as he gets in the album (along with the single, Belief, which takes on the Iraq war), with the rest of the tracks taking a very soulful blues tone.

The reason why I have a high regard for this talented, self-conscious singer-songwriter is that his sense of introspection is unparalleled. And this brings us with very subtle, yet profound lyrics which offers us a different point of view of our world.

He may not appeal to everyone but, his work does to me, because I could relate to it. His music grows along with me, from the high-school angst in No Such Thing, the fumbling flirt in Your Body is a Wonderland, to the self-assured promising, idealistic youthful in Bigger than my Body, and virtually all his other songs.

With this album, I can sense a continuing growth and maturity in the artist as he talks about his ideals/beliefs and how he moves on from a bad relationship.

Also, he does a great cover of a Jimi Hendrix original, Bold as Love... a song which showcases his guitar skills.

5 stars to this album. This guy's good, and he'll continue to grow, and talk/sing about things that will continue to be relevant and that spring from his heart.
